RANCHO PALOS VERDES, Calif. — Officials say two-wheeled vehicles, including motorcycles and bicycles, will soon be banned from riding along a precarious 0.8-mile stretch of Palos Verdes Drive South along Portuguese Bend due to safety concerns.

They say conditions are changing almost daily, as ongoing land movement wreaks havoc on roadways and buildings in the area.

Cyclists say the ban is unnecessary and discriminatory, and they don't believe the city will be able to enforce it.
